Wonderful World of Worms

Get ready to dig in + discover the magic beneath our feet! Join us on Friday, July 10th for a hands-on Farm School session all about the wiggly wonders of the soil—worms. Young learners will explore the important role worms play in recycling nutrients, enriching the soil, and helping plants grow strong and healthy. With guidance from a worm expert at Wildwood Hills Ranch, students will uncover fascinating facts about these tiny but mighty helpers—learning what worms need to thrive, from food and air to space to grow. Then it’s time to dig in! Children will observe live worms up close + even help sift through nutrient-rich worm castings to see firsthand how worms work their magic in the garden. Our friends from the West Des Moines Public Library will join us for a delightful, nature-themed story. It’s a morning full of discovery, curiosity, and just the right amount of farmyard fun, perfect for budding gardeners + little explorers alike!

Jeni Warwick

Farm School educator Jeni Warwick joined the Rose Farm team in 2023. Jeni is a licensed kindergarten teacher in the state of Iowa, currently serving in the Norwalk School District. With over 18 years of experience as a kindergarten teacher, Jeni’s warm, bubbly + kind spirit makes her the perfect fit for Farm School. She has a strong passion for teaching, children, animals, reading, running, traveling, and the beauty of nature. Jeni also enjoys spending time with her husband + two children, and teaching ballet at a Des Moines-based studio.
